Subject: Re: [PATCH net-next] page_pool: check if nmdesc->pp is !NULL to confirm its usage as pp for net_iov

On Thu, Oct 16, 2025 at 03:36:57PM +0900, Byungchul Park wrote:
> ->pp_magic field in struct page is current used to identify if a page
> belongs to a page pool.  However, ->pp_magic will be removed and page
> type bit in struct page e.g. PGTY_netpp should be used for that purpose.
> 
> As a preparation, the check for net_iov, that is not page-backed, should
> avoid using ->pp_magic since net_iov doens't have to do with page type.
> Instead, nmdesc->pp can be used if a net_iov or its nmdesc belongs to a
> page pool, by making sure nmdesc->pp is NULL otherwise.
> 
> For page-backed netmem, just leave unchanged as is, while for net_iov,
> make sure nmdesc->pp is initialized to NULL and use nmdesc->pp for the
> check.

> Signed-off-by: Byungchul Park <byungchul@sk.com>
> ---
>  io_uring/zcrx.c        |  4 ++++
>  net/core/devmem.c      |  1 +
>  net/core/netmem_priv.h |  6 ++++++
>  net/core/page_pool.c   | 16 ++++++++++++++--
>  4 files changed, 25 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/io_uring/zcrx.c b/io_uring/zcrx.c
> index 723e4266b91f..cf78227c0ca6 100644
> --- a/io_uring/zcrx.c
> +++ b/io_uring/zcrx.c
> @@ -450,6 +450,10 @@ static int io_zcrx_create_area(struct io_zcrx_ifq *ifq,
>  		area->freelist[i] = i;
>  		atomic_set(&area->user_refs[i], 0);
>  		niov->type = NET_IOV_IOURING;
> +
> +		/* niov->desc.pp is already initialized to NULL by
> +		 * kvmalloc_array(__GFP_ZERO).
> +		 */
>  	}
>  
>  	area->free_count = nr_iovs;
> diff --git a/net/core/devmem.c b/net/core/devmem.c
> index d9de31a6cc7f..f81b700f1fd1 100644
> --- a/net/core/devmem.c
> +++ b/net/core/devmem.c
> @@ -291,6 +291,7 @@ net_devmem_bind_dmabuf(struct net_device *dev,
>  			niov = &owner->area.niovs[i];
>  			niov->type = NET_IOV_DMABUF;
>  			niov->owner = &owner->area;
> +			niov->desc.pp = NULL;
>  			page_pool_set_dma_addr_netmem(net_iov_to_netmem(niov),
>  						      net_devmem_get_dma_addr(niov));
>  			if (direction == DMA_TO_DEVICE)
> diff --git a/net/core/netmem_priv.h b/net/core/netmem_priv.h
> index 23175cb2bd86..fb21cc19176b 100644
> --- a/net/core/netmem_priv.h
> +++ b/net/core/netmem_priv.h
> @@ -22,6 +22,12 @@ static inline void netmem_clear_pp_magic(netmem_ref netmem)
>  
>  static inline bool netmem_is_pp(netmem_ref netmem)
>  {
> +	/* Use ->pp for net_iov to identify if it's pp, which requires
> +	 * that non-pp net_iov should have ->pp NULL'd.
> +	 */
> +	if (netmem_is_net_iov(netmem))
> +		return !!netmem_to_nmdesc(netmem)->pp;
> +
>  	return (netmem_get_pp_magic(netmem) & PP_MAGIC_MASK) == PP_SIGNATURE;
>  }
>  
> diff --git a/net/core/page_pool.c b/net/core/page_pool.c
> index 1a5edec485f1..2756b78754b0 100644
> --- a/net/core/page_pool.c
> +++ b/net/core/page_pool.c
> @@ -699,7 +699,13 @@ s32 page_pool_inflight(const struct page_pool *pool, bool strict)
>  void page_pool_set_pp_info(struct page_pool *pool, netmem_ref netmem)
>  {
>  	netmem_set_pp(netmem, pool);
> -	netmem_or_pp_magic(netmem, PP_SIGNATURE);
> +
> +	/* For page-backed, pp_magic is used to identify if it's pp.
> +	 * For net_iov, it's ensured nmdesc->pp is non-NULL if it's pp
> +	 * and nmdesc->pp is NULL if it's not.
> +	 */
> +	if (!netmem_is_net_iov(netmem))
> +		netmem_or_pp_magic(netmem, PP_SIGNATURE);
>  
>  	/* Ensuring all pages have been split into one fragment initially:
>  	 * page_pool_set_pp_info() is only called once for every page when it
> @@ -714,7 +720,13 @@ void page_pool_set_pp_info(struct page_pool *pool, netmem_ref netmem)
>  
>  void page_pool_clear_pp_info(netmem_ref netmem)
>  {
> -	netmem_clear_pp_magic(netmem);
> +	/* For page-backed, pp_magic is used to identify if it's pp.
> +	 * For net_iov, it's ensured nmdesc->pp is non-NULL if it's pp
> +	 * and nmdesc->pp is NULL if it's not.
> +	 */
> +	if (!netmem_is_net_iov(netmem))
> +		netmem_clear_pp_magic(netmem);
> +
>  	netmem_set_pp(netmem, NULL);
>  }
>
